Fly91 Flight Diverted to Bengaluru Amid Bad Weather

fly91 — IN news

What happens when a flight is diverted due to severe weather? For the 22 passengers aboard Fly91’s flight from Hyderabad to Hubballi on April 19, 2026, the answer involved unexpected turbulence and a detour to Bengaluru.

The aircraft took off from Hyderabad at 3:30 PM, scheduled to land in Hubballi by 4:30 PM. However, as the plane approached its destination, conditions worsened. The aircraft circled Hubballi for nearly an hour—an anxious wait for the passengers on board—before it was finally redirected to Bengaluru, landing safely at around 6:30 PM.

All passengers were reported safe following the diversion, though many experienced panic during the turbulent flight. A video capturing their distress circulated widely on social media, underscoring the emotional weight of such incidents. Yet Fly91 reassured everyone: “There was zero compromise to safety.” An airport official confirmed that the diversion was a necessary decision due to adverse weather conditions.

Fly91 emphasized that this procedure is standard during poor visibility or unstable weather—prioritizing passenger safety over strict adherence to schedule. Reports suggesting a technical fault with the aircraft were labeled as false and baseless by the airline.

After deplaning in Bengaluru, 18 of the original passengers continued their journey back to Hubballi on a later flight at approximately 11 PM. The day was marked by similar weather-related disruptions across the region, adding further context to this incident.
